What is Ballistic Dyneema Fabric?

Ballistic Dyneema tela is made from Ultra-High Molecular Weight Polyethylene (UHMWPE), a synthetic fiber known for its high strength-to-weight ratio and resistance to abrasion, cuts, and impacts. This fabric has been engineered to meet the specific demands of military-grade applications, including body armor, protective vests, and tactical gear. The unique properties of Dyneema allow it to provide a level of ballistic protection that is both lightweight and effective.

Key Advantages of Ballistic Dyneema Fabric

Lightweight and Comfortable

One of the most significant advantages of Ballistic Dyneema fabric is its lightweight nature. Unlike traditional ballistic materials, which can be cumbersome and restrict movement, Dyneema fabric allows for greater mobility and comfort. This is particularly important for military personnel and tactical operators who need to remain agile in dynamic environments. The reduced weight also means that soldiers can carry additional equipment without being burdened.

Exceptional Strength and Durability

Ballistic Dyneema fabric exhibits extraordinary strength and durability, making it an ideal choice for protective gear. Its high tensile strength means that it can withstand extreme conditions without tearing or wearing out. Additionally, Dyneema is resistant to moisture, chemicals, and UV radiation, ensuring that it maintains its protective qualities over time, even in harsh environments.

Effective Ballistic Protection

Ballistic Dyneema fabric is specifically designed to provide effective protection against various ballistic threats. Its construction allows it to absorb and disperse the energy of projectiles, reducing the impact on the wearer. Various layers of Dyneema can be combined in armor systems to achieve different levels of protection, catering to the specific needs of military and law enforcement personnel.

Applications of Ballistic Dyneema Fabric

Military Body Armor

One of the primary applications of Ballistic Dyneema fabric is in the manufacturing of body armor. Military forces around the world utilize Dyneema-based vests and plates to protect their soldiers from bullets and shrapnel. The lightweight and flexible nature of the fabric enables comfortable long-term wear, essential during extended missions.

Tactical Gear

Beyond body armor, Ballistic Dyneema is also used in the production of various tactical gear, including backpacks, pouches, and helmets. The durability and resistance to elements ensure that these items remain functional and reliable. Operators can trust that their gear will hold up under pressure, whether in combat situations or during training.

Law Enforcement Applications

Law enforcement agencies have also recognized the benefits of Ballistic Dyneema fabric. Officers can use Dyneema in their protective vests, which provide essential protection during high-risk operations. The lightweight gear allows for enhanced mobility, enabling officers to carry out their duties effectively while remaining safe.
